Acreage Clearing in Atlanta, GA
Acreage clearing services involve removing trees, brush, shrubs, and other vegetation from large plots of land to prepare the property for development, landscaping, or agricultural use. This process is often used for projects such as building new homes, creating open spaces for recreational areas, installing utilities, or establishing farmland. Property owners typically want to understand the scope of clearing needed, including whether stumps, roots, or debris will be removed, and what equipment will be used to ensure the land is properly prepared for its intended purpose.
Before requesting acreage clearing, property owners should consider the size and topography of the land, as well as any local regulations or permits required for vegetation removal. Clarifying the types of vegetation present and the desired outcome-such as maintaining some trees or creating a completely cleared site-can help determine the most effective approach. Proper planning ensures the land is cleared efficiently and safely, aligning with future project goals.

Common Acreage Clearing Jobs
Tree and brush clearing - removes overgrown vegetation to improve property accessibility and safety.
Stump removal - eliminates remaining tree stumps to prevent pest issues and allow for future landscaping.
Lot clearing - prepares land for construction, gardening, or new landscaping projects.
Firebreak clearing - creates defensible space around properties in fire-prone areas.
Fence line clearing - maintains clear boundaries and prevents overgrowth from encroaching on fences.
Land leveling and grading - ensures proper drainage and a stable foundation for development or landscaping.
